Exchange rate determination: conversion rates for specified foreign currencies set for import and export valuation purposes. The Central Board of Excise and Customs, under section 14 of the Customs Act, 1962, notifies conversion rates for specified foreign currencies to Indian rupees effective 7th April, 2017, superseding an earlier notification; Schedule I provides per unit rupee equivalents for listed currencies with separate import and export rates, and Schedule II provides rupee equivalents for 100 units of specified currencies for import and export valuation purposes.
